Originally Posted by dodge dude94
Pretty cool of your girl to be working on it. I wish there were more out there...


I see something glaringly wrong with this picture: STACKED BLOCKS.

bahsgopjrafljiragijrigj...NO!

Other than that, nice rig.
+2 have the blocks welded together ( 1 inch stitch on front and rear of block) or replace with 1 big block

Originally Posted by redhemi06
hmh never knew that you couldnt do that, that is just how i got it. ill have to fix that when i get it to houston, i actually am considering going up another 4-6". how would one go about doing that? i cant seem to find much on lifts more than 6".
I don't know if you're aware of how much $ you have to throw at the truck in order to get 10-12" of lift, but here it is anyway.

You can do 7 or 8 inch diesel springs up front which will get you about 10 or 11 inches of lift and add spacers as needed. For the rear, there's a bunch of ways to achieve lift; 4" BDS shackle flip and 1" zero rate block with correct offset, and 6" springs. Or AALs, springs, and regular blocks. Or any other combo you want. You can also throw in a 3" body lift in place of suspension lift height. Your gonna have to make your own control arms and trackbar unless you wanna have them custom made by dtprofab or dodgeoffroad. You also need an extreme drop pitman arm, extended sway bar links/drop bracket, and custom length shocks. You will also have to install a tcase indexing ring kit so the driveshaft has the correct angle. Its also a very good idea to get crossover steering and hydro steering. 1 ton axles and some low (5.13 or so) gears are a must as well, which means 8 lug rims. Diff lockers are a good idea too if you're gonna be getting deep into mud.
And depending on how big of tires your gonna get, rockwell axles might be a better choice than 1 tons.

Fabricating things yourself and shopping around will help to make things cheap as possible.

Another, more expensive option, is to do a 7" skyjacker lift with a 3" body lift. Simpler than piecing a kit together, but more expensive. And I would highly advise against buying full throttle suspension/whiplash lift kits. From what others say, they're junk and not safe, especially for offroad use. Their 10" coils are fine to use though.
